Textron’s Cessna division scored its second fleet order of the day via jet card and fractional operator Fly Alliance
Fly Alliance said it ordered 20 new private jets from Textron Aviation, the second fleet order of the day after FlyExclusive announced an order early this morning.
Alliance Aviation is a newly former jet card and on-demand charter brokerage with offices in Providence, Rhode Island, and Orlando, Florida. The company offers jet cards with guaranteed availability and fixed one-way pricing. It also provides full concierge services, including hotel reservations. Sister Part 135 charter operator Wing has a fleet of Gulfstream GIVs, Challenger 605s, and Hawker 800XPs.
